ISO 6623:2013 specifies the essential dimensional features of scraper rings made of cast iron, types N, NM, E, and EM, having diameters from 30 mm up to and including 200 mm, used in reciprocating internal combustion engines for road vehicles and other applications.

Overview
ISO 6623:2013 specifies essential dimensional features and related requirements for scraper piston rings made of cast iron (types N, NM, E, EM) used in reciprocating internal combustion engines for road vehicles and other applications. The standard applies to rings with nominal diameters from 30 mm up to and including 200 mm and defines geometry, tolerances, coatings, force factors and designation examples to support consistent design, manufacture and quality control.
Key topics and technical requirements
- Ring types and geometry
- Type N (Napier / undercut step), NM (Napier taper-faced), E (stepped scraper), EM (stepped taper-faced).
- Diagrams and detail views (Figures 1–5) show reference planes, top-side marks, and running-edge features.
- Dimensional tables
- Comprehensive tables for nominal diameters, radial wall thickness options (“regular” and “D/22”), ring widths, closed gaps, axial step widths and tolerances (Tables 8–9).
- Example designation format included (e.g., “Piston ring ISO 6623 NM4 - 90 × 2,5 - MC21/PO”).
- Peripheral surface options
- Taper codes (e.g., M2 ≈ 30′, M3 ≈ 60′, M4 ≈ 90′) with tolerances for ground or unground plated surfaces.
- Partly cylindrical machined (LM) or lapped (LP) bottom running-edge options and axial extents (Figure 7, Table 4).
- Edge and coating specifications
- Inside chamfer (KI) sizes by diameter range and tolerances (Table 3).
- Coating/plating options with minimum thicknesses: chromium plating (CRF, CR1, CR2) and spray/inlaid coatings (SC1F–SC4F) with specified thicknesses (e.g., CRF 0.005 mm, CR1 0.05 mm, CR2 0.1 mm; SC1F 0.05 mm, SC2F 0.1 mm, etc.).
- Force factors and corrections
- Tangential and diametral force data and correction factors for coatings, KI and materials (Tables 6–7). Designers must correct tabulated forces when using materials/coatings different from the baseline grey cast iron.
- Special variants
- Mini Napier/stepped (RU) - reduced undercut dimensions and adjusted force factors.
Practical applications and users
ISO 6623:2013 is intended for:
- Engine designers and OEMs specifying piston ring geometry for road-vehicle and industrial reciprocating engines.
- Piston-ring manufacturers and foundries producing cast iron scraper rings.
- Quality engineers, procurement teams and test laboratories verifying conformance to dimensional and coating requirements.
- Aftermarket parts suppliers ensuring interchangeability and reliable sealing/scraping performance.
Benefits include standardized interchangeability, reliable sealing/scraping behavior, and clearer supplier specifications for production and inspection.
Related standards
- ISO 6621 series (notably ISO 6621-4) - referenced for general piston ring specifications and force corrections.
- Other ISO piston-ring parts (ISO 6621, ISO 6622, ISO 6624–6627) for complementary ring types and test methods.
